Abstract

The present invention provides compounds and pharmaceutical formulations useful as progesterone receptor agonists and antagonists and having the general formula: wherein: A is O, S, or NR 4 ; B is a bond or CR 5 R 6 ; R 4 , R 5 , and R 6 are H, C 1 to C 6 alkyl, C 2 to C 6 alkenyl, C 2 to C 6 alkynyl, C 3 to C 8 cycloalkyl, C 3 to C 8 cycloalkyl, aryl, or heterocyclic ring, or R 4 and R 5 form a 5 to 7 membered ring; R 1 is H, OH, NH 2 , C 1 to C 6 alkyl, C 3 to C 6 alkenyl, alkynyl, or COR A ; R 2 is H, halogen, CN, NO 2 , C 1 to C 6 alkyl, C 1 to C 6 alkoxy, or C 1 to C 6 aminoalkyl; R 3 is a substituted benzene ring or heterocyclic ring; Q is O, S, NR 8 , or CR 9 R 10 ; or a pharmaceutically acceptable salt thereof The invention also includes methods of contraception and methods of treating or preventing maladies associated with the progesterone receptor.
